The Basics of Container Delivery
Container delivery refers to the transportation of cargo in big standardized containers between suppliers, producers, and clients. Making use of containers has streamlined shipping processes, facilitating quicker and more trusted delivery techniques. The containers, typically made from steel, can be found in various sizes and are created to be quickly loaded onto ships, trucks, and trains.

Types of Shipping Containers
Shipping containers can be categorized into several types based on their usage and specs:
Container Type | Description |
---|---|
Standard Containers | General-purpose containers ideal for most cargo types. |
Reefer Containers | Temperature-controlled containers for perishable products. |
Flat Rack Containers | Open-top containers for heavy or oversized cargo. |
Open Top Containers | Containers with detachable tops for high cargo. |
Tank Containers | Developed for transporting liquids, consisting of chemicals and fuels. |
Advantages of Container Delivery
The benefits of container delivery are numerous and include:
- Efficiency: Standardized containers can be quickly moved in between different modes of transport, minimizing handling time and potential delays.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Bulk shipping in containers reduces transportation costs due to economies of scale.
- Security: Containers offer a safe method to transport items, minimizing the threat of theft or damage.
- Versatility: Containers can carry a variety of items, from electronic devices to agricultural items.
- Lowered Carbon Footprint: Shipping by container is normally more fuel-efficient than other types of transport, contributing to lower greenhouse gas emissions.
Difficulties in Container Delivery
Regardless of its benefits, container delivery likewise faces a number of difficulties:
- Congestion and Delays: Major ports frequently experience blockage, resulting in delays in shipping schedules.
- Damage and Theft: While containers provide security, goods can still be harmed during transit or stolen at ports.
- Regulatory Compliance: Different countries have differing guidelines and policies that need to be complied with, complicating international shipping.
- Facilities Issues: Not all ports and transportation networks are equipped to handle large containers efficiently.

Frequently asked questions
1. What are the standard sizes of Shipping Solutions containers?
- The most typical sizes of shipping containers are 20-foot and 40-foot containers.
2. What types of cargo can be carried in containers?
- Containers can carry a large range of items, including electronics, clothing, machinery, and perishable products.
3. How is shipping cost figured out in container delivery?
- Shipping costs are typically based upon the weight, size of the cargo, range, and the mode of transport.
4. What is a reefer container?
- A reefer container is a refrigerated container Used Containers specifically for transporting disposable items that need temperature control.
